Scottish Opera: The Pirates of Penzance

The Pirates of Penzance was written in a hurry so that Gilbert & Sullivan could open it on Broadway and finally taste those sweet, sweet American royalties, but in spite of its mercenary origin it's one of the best-loved operettas ever written, a crazily sparkling farce with a bumbling but patriotic pirate crew, some…

The Doctor's Dilemma

  • Directed by: Chris Holmes
  • Written by: George Bernard Shaw

Featuring an array of larger than life medics, hilarious in their absurdity, who make a rich living peddling quack remedies to a credulous public, George Bernard Shaw's 1906 play brilliantly satirises the private medical profession of his day.
